FLUE MEASURING & CUTTING
Flue bends:
1
Connecting flue bends increases the
effective pipe length and an allowance
must be made for the different connectors.
The example opposite shows dimensions
for two 90° bends connected to a standard
flue extension.
Adjusting the standard terminal length:
2
Extend tube (A) by withdrawing from
tube (B) to achieve the flue length required,
310- 530mm.
Secure with screw provided and seal
joint with the aluminium tape supplied.
Reducing the standard terminal length:
3
Remove securing screws (C) to detach
the terminal assembly from the connector.
Slide terminal section (B) from the
terminal assembly and discard.
To use terminal (A) without cutting
remove the location lug (D) on the inner
flue tube (E) and remove any burrs.
To reduce the terminal length further:
4
Mark the length required for the terminal
(A) as shown (min. 130mm) and cut square,
taking care not to damage the tubes.
Remove any burrs and chamfer the outer
edge of the tubes to assist ease of
connection and prevent seal damage.
NOTE: The aluminium tape is not required
when reducing the terminal.
Reducing extended flue tube length:
Only cut flue extension & not flue terminal.
5
Mark flue extension (F) to the required
distance measuring from the socket end
and cut square taking care not to damage
the tubes.
Remove any burrs and chamfer the outer
edge of the tubes to assist ease of
connection and prevent seal damage.
